Dealing with more than one ship at once is very difficult unless they are very bad and/or you have a far superior ship with links/implants/drugs. Good fit with good pilot and aforementioned trump cards can put up a decent fight against a small gang, but with frigs especially there's not much you can do once backup starts landing.

Watch dscan, watch local, don't get blobbed. Like the man said, kiters are nice for solo because you can OH mwd and bail when the blob starts converging.

this situation requires situational awareness.

tips to not die:

- watch local, if it spikes, suspect they are in a group

-when there are flashies in local, they are either fighting eachother or are together. either means bad juju for a solo pilot

-watching dscan is great, but you need to watch what is happening both near you and at max range. this means changing the range at which you are scanning quite often

-if you are brawl fit, realize that when you fight you are committed, for better or for worse. know what you are fighting and what you are flying

-if you are kite, realize that you have much more gtfo ability (and you should use it whenever you feel the need to, ESPECIALLY when your gut says 'frak this") than a brawl fit but you have trade offs

other than those key points, you just need practice mate which means killing and losing ships. fly dangerous o7
